Spring: Refresh, Rejuvenate, and Prepare
Spring is the ideal time to lay the foundation for a healthy and vibrant yard. As the ground thaws and plants begin to wake from winter dormancy, we focus on several key tasks to kick off the growing season.
Seasonal Clean-Up and Lawn Preparation
Removing debris, fallen branches, and leftover leaves is crucial to prevent mold and ensure your lawn breathes. We recommend aerating your lawn to improve soil drainage and encourage strong root development.
Spring is also a great time to apply fertilizer and pre-emergent weed control. These treatments support grass growth while minimizing unwanted weeds before they have a chance to sprout.
Mulching and Pruning
Adding fresh mulch to your garden beds not only improves the look of your yard but also helps retain moisture and suppress weeds. We also handle strategic pruning during this time to shape trees and shrubs, removing any winter-damaged limbs to encourage healthy new growth.
Summer: Maintain and Monitor
With warm weather in full swing, summer is about consistent care and monitoring. Keeping your yard well-maintained during this time will help it withstand heat, pests, and potential droughts.
Regular Lawn Care and Irrigation
Our lawncare service in Freehold includes mowing, trimming, and monitoring soil moisture levels. Adjusting irrigation systems and watering schedules is crucial during summer to ensure your lawn and plants stay hydrated without overwatering.
Pest Control and Plant Health
We keep an eye out for signs of common pests and plant diseases that tend to appear in warmer months. Prompt action helps preserve your landscape and keeps your outdoor space enjoyable.
If you have hardscaping features, summer is also a good time to inspect them for cracks or wear and ensure everything remains in great shape.
Fall: Strengthen and Protect
As temperatures cool, fall becomes a time for preparation. We shift our focus to reinforcing your landscape so it’s ready to handle the upcoming winter months.
Leaf Removal and Fertilization
Clearing fallen leaves from your lawn is more than just about aesthetics—it prevents lawn suffocation and mold development. We also apply fall fertilizer to help grass roots grow deeper and remain strong through winter.

Winter: Protect and Plan Ahead
While winter brings dormancy, it doesn’t mean landscape maintenance stops. With the right approach, you can protect your investment and get a head start on the next growing season.
Winterization and Safety
We make sure irrigation systems are properly winterized to prevent freezing and damage. If snow removal or salting is needed on your property, we can provide referrals or coordinate services depending on the situation.
Trees and shrubs are wrapped or mulched to protect against freeze damage and drying winds. This is especially important for newer plantings and sensitive species.
